Cloudflare report reveals causes of recent internet outages

Cloudflare has released a new study highlighting the vulnerabilities of the global internet. The report details how disasters, shutdowns, and cable damage contribute to outages. Even minor incidents, like a stray bullet in Texas, can disrupt network connections.

In its latest analysis, Cloudflare examines the fragility of internet infrastructure worldwide. The study, published on November 2, 2025, uncovers a range of factors behind recent disruptions, including natural disasters such as fires and earthquakes, political interventions, and sheer bad luck.

The report emphasizes that small-scale events can have outsized impacts. For instance, a stray bullet in Texas severed connections, affecting broader network reliability. This underscores ongoing challenges in maintaining resilient digital systems amid diverse threats.

Cloudflare's findings serve as a call to improve safeguards against both predictable and unforeseen risks, ensuring more stable internet access globally.
